Spotlight on the Pediatric Anxiety Research Center (PARC) at Bradley Hospital

The Pediatric Anxiety Research Center at Bradley Hospital has provided assessment and leading-edge treatment for children with ob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D) and other anxiety disorders for the past 25 years. In this anniversary video, meet PARC team members and patients and learn about the lifechanging work our doctors, clinicians, and exposure coaches do every day to transform the lives of kids and families.

A Gratitude Story from Bradley Hospital

Thirteen-year-old Paul Doyle’s world had shrunk to the size of his bedroom, where his battle with OCD kept him isolated from the people and activities he loved. For months, he avoided any contact, gripped by overwhelming fears of germs, meat, and dairy. His parents, Tom and Bonnie, felt helpless watching their son struggle.

A Brown University Health Blog by Greta Francis, PhD
Dr. Francis is a child psychologist and clinical director of the Bradley Schools - private, school-funded educational programs for children and adolescents whose psychiatric and behavioral needs cannot be met in a public-school setting. Bradley Schools serve more than 400 youth through 6 freestanding schools in Rhode Island and Connecticut.

Helping children on the path to becoming successful and thriving adults can take on many forms. One of those is social emotional learning, or the ability to work collaboratively and maintain positive relationships with co-workers, friends, and loved ones.
